A False Liberation , 2020
11 x 15 in (h x w)
Traditional Ink Pen, Digitalized Color

The falsehoods that the Victorian Empire has taught its citizens have come to a terrible realization within Rhabe (Center). The so called “Liberation” of the Mienese people was actually an unjust invasion. Caught between the chaos, Rabe and his assistant Tietyien (Center Left) stare in horror at the atrocities being committed around them.
